How much does Highmark pay in Wisconsin?

The average Highmark salary in Wisconsin is $50,706. Highmark salaries range between $28,000 to $91,000 per year in Wisconsin. Highmark Wisconsin based pay is lower than Highmark's United States average salary of $51,667. The best-paying job in Wisconsin at Highmark is medical director, which pays an average of $218,630 annually.

Highmark salaries in Wisconsin by job title

Highmark’s highest-paying job in Wisconsin is medical director, with an average salary of $218,630. In second place is corporate director, which pays $162,100 annually in Wisconsin.

Highmark salaries in Wisconsin by department

The departments with the highest salaries for Highmark employees in Wisconsin are Engineering, Marketing, and Plant/Manufacturing.

Wisconsin Highmark employees in the Engineering department earn an average salary of $88,929 a year, compared to an average salary of $81,898 in the Marketing department and $78,760 in the Plant/Manufacturing department.
